About this fingerprint
JA4 is a fingerprint of the TLS Client Hello: the version, cipher suites, extensions and signature algorithms a client offers when it opens an HTTPS connection. Clients built on the same library and version produce the same JA4, which makes it a durable handle on the tool behind the traffic.
